The surname Ramirez Garcia is a combination of two common Hispanic surnames, Ramirez and Garcia. Both surnames have rich histories and are found throughout the Spanish-speaking world. The surname Ramirez is of Spanish origin and is derived from the personal name Ramiro, which means "famous judge" or "wise protector." The surname Garcia is also of Spanish origin and is derived from the personal name Garcia, which means "young warrior" or "the bear."
